[PATCH 06/20] uuidd: factor out socket creation into separate function

+/*
+ * Create AF_UNIX, SOCK_STREAM socket and bind to @socket_path
+ *
+ * If @will_fork is true, then make sure the descriptor
+ * of the socket is >2, so that it wont be later closed
+ * during create_daemon().
+ *
+ * Return file descriptor corresponding to created socket.
+ */
+static int create_socket(const char *socket_path, int will_fork, int quiet)
